Heating accounts for nearly 50% of the world's total final energy consumption and 40% of global CO2 emissions. While solar PV dominates electricity conversations, Solar Thermal technology remains the most efficient pathway to decarbonizing industrial processes, district heating, and residential hot water.
Unlike PV panels that convert 15-22% of sunlight into electricity, solar thermal collectors can capture up to 70-80% of solar radiation as usable heat. For OEM/ODM partners, this high energy density translates to faster ROI for end-users and lower structural footprints.
The next frontier in solar energy is SHIP. From food pasteurization and textile dyeing to chemical production, industrial heat requires temperatures between 60°C and 400°C. We are integrating nano-ceramic and multi-layer cermet coatings that maximize absorption in the solar spectrum while minimizing thermal emittance. This technology allows collectors to function effectively even in low-irradiance regions like Northern Europe and Canada.
The future is hybrid. PVT modules produce both electricity and heat simultaneously. By cooling the PV cells with a circulating fluid, electrical efficiency is increased by 10-15%, while the harvested heat is used for heat pump source boosting or pre-heating water.
Solving the intermittency of solar energy requires Phase Change Materials (PCMs). Our R&D team is optimizing tank designs that incorporate paraffin-based or salt-hydrate PCMs to provide heat for up to 12 hours after sunset.
